Transaction 3abcf121ddbb10a7946f012ccc275d668700c35a7e9141c18e5fe2f6b1458e0b
1 Input
1 Output
-
3abcf121ddbb10a7946f012ccc275d668700c35a7e9141c18e5fe2f6b1458e0b:0
- value
- 349169
- script pubkey
- OP_0 OP_PUSHBYTES_20 687be87b2319aa5a4c6d9b0a8735685982045c3d
- address
- bc1qdpa7s7errx495nrdnv9gwdtgtxpqghpadg5aj6